How far is Tuscaloosa, AL from Meridianville, AL?

The driving distance from Tuscaloosa, AL to Meridianville, AL is about 163.5 miles (263.2 km), with a travel time of about 03h 02m by car.

  • The straight-line flight distance is about 127 miles (204.4 km).
  • For a round trip, plan for roughly 06h 04m of driving time before adding stops, traffic, or weather delays.

How long does it take to drive from Tuscaloosa to Meridianville?

The road trip is about 163.5 miles (263.2 km) and usually takes 03h 02m in normal driving conditions.

Is this a same-day trip or an overnight route?

This is still possible in one day, but it becomes a long driving day. Leaving early and planning your stop window matters more here.

What is the halfway point on this route?

Smoke Rise is a useful midpoint, sitting about 81.8 miles from Tuscaloosa and 81.7 miles from Meridianville.

How much longer is the road route than the straight-line distance?

The direct path is about 127 miles (204.4 km), while the road route adds roughly 36.5 extra miles because roads do not follow the straight air line.
